Synthesis and Structure Assignments of Novel Azolinone Ribonucleosides
Abstract

Ribosidation of 4-imidazolin-2-one gave 1-(beta)-D-ribofuranosyl-4-imidazolin-2-one; of 1,2,4-triazolin-3-one gave 1-, 2-, and 4-(beta)-D-ribofuranosyl-1,2,4-triazolin-3-one, and 2,4-bis-(beta)-D-ribofuranosyl-1,2,4-triazolin-3-one; and of 2-tetrazolin-5-one gave 1-(beta)-D-ribofuranosyl-2-tetrazolin-5-one and 1,4-bis-(beta)-D-ribofuranosyl-2-tetrazolin-5-one. Structure assignments were based on microanalyses and ('1)H and ('13)C NMR spectra. The triazolinone mono-riboside isomer structures are differentiated by ('13)C NMR long-range coupling patterns, and two of the assignments were confirmed by X-ray crystallography. Improved syntheses were developed for two of the ribosides by fashioning the azolinone rings onto 2,3,5-tri-O-benzoylribofuranosyl isocyanate. Reaction of 2,3,5-tri-O-benzoylribofuranosyl isocyanate with (alpha)-aminoacetaldehyde diethyl acetal gave N-(2,2-diethoxyethyl)-N'-(beta)-D-(2,3,5-tri-O-benzoylribofuranosyl)-4-imidazolin-2-one in the presence of acid. Addition of formic acid hydrazide to 2,3,5-tri-O-benzoylribofuranosyl isocyanate gave 1-formyl-4-(beta)-D-(2,3,5-tri-O-benzoyl-ribofuranosyl)semicarbazide, which gave 4-(beta)-D-(2,3,5-tri-O-benzoylribofuranosyl)-1,2,4-triazolin-3-one upon dehydrative silylation. Methyl N-carbomethoxyformimidate was synthesized as a possible reagent for the synthesis of the other 1,2,4-triazolin-3-one products.
